Describe your experience supporting clients with mergers and acquisitions, including the due diligence process, and integrating the acquired company’s benefits plans with the client’s benefit plans, communications to employees, etc. This team has a sub-specialty of M&A due diligence work. Many of our clients grow through acquisition. One client completed five acquisitions in one calendar year. EBS can produce a mergers & acquisition report outlining Gross and Net costs, areas of concern and side-by-side plan comparisons. We can also evaluate employee contribution impact to the employer and employee and assist with the integration of the acquired company’s benefit programs. We use local and national benchmarking data effectively illustrate how the target firm’s plans, costs and contributions fit into the client’s current benefits ecosystem. Describe your experience assisting clients with complicated administrative issues and fostering positive resolution. From time to time, EBS is required to intervene on behalf of our clients when working with claims and administrative issues. To resolve this quickly and to foster a positive resolution, we draw on our strong carrier and vendor relationships and rely on our EBS team members who have prior experience on the carrier or vendor side of the relationship. We currently have six team members with experience working for regional and national insurance carriers in sales, service, underwriting and operational capacities.
